Quote:
Originally Posted by Ectomorphic View Post
That's odd.
It's actually quite common for right-handed people to be stronger and/or better developed on their left side. If you look at my very first progress picture (at 215 pounds/30% body fat), even then you can see that my left pec is bigger than my right pec.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Ectomorphic View Post
But on a somewhat related note, do you find that keeping proper form is easier on your non-dominant side than it is on your dominant one?
I can't say that's been a problem. Interestingly, my smaller right side seems to be about the same strength as my left side. For example, when I do single arm dumbbell curls, I fail at the same rep on both sides almost every time. Same with lateral raises, dumbbell rows, flyes and on and on...
